How to Choose a Clash Royale Ladder Deck (2026)
- Win condition clarity: A strong ladder deck has one or two clear offensive anchors. If you can’t name your primary win condition in three words or fewer, your deck is probably trying to do too much.
- Elixir curve balance: Every deck lives or dies by its elixir management. Favor builds that keep your average cost between 3.0 and 4.0 so you can defend and counter-push without hemorrhaging resources.
- Meta adaptability: The best ladder decks aren’t rigid. They have slots that flex between cycle options and heavier tanks depending on what you’re seeing at your trophy range. Build for adjustability, not perfection.
- Counter-push synergy: After a successful defense, your surviving troops should convert naturally into a threatening push. Cards that double as both defenders and attackers are worth far more than pure specialists.
- Practice and mastery depth: Choose a deck that rewards repetition. Ladder climbing rewards muscle memory and timing knowledge over raw novelty, so pick something you’ll enjoy running fifty games in a row.

What makes a Clash Royale ladder deck different from a tournament deck?
Ladder decks need to handle a wider range of unknown matchups since you can’t scout opponents. Tournament decks can be tuned against a specific meta, but ladder builds must stay versatile enough to beat anything you’ll face in a fifty-game push.
How often should I change my ladder deck?
Stick with a deck for at least 200 games before judging it. Most players switch too early and never develop the timing instincts that make a deck feel natural. Only swap when the meta genuinely shifts against your win condition, not after a single bad session.

What trophy range should I target before focusing on a specific deck archetype?
Once you’re past 5,000 trophies, the meta stabilizes enough that specializing pays off. Below that threshold, focus on learning fundamentals with a well-rounded deck, then commit to a focused archetype once your defensive fundamentals are solid.
